SUMMARY
***GUIDE PRICE ?90,000-?100,000***
A really attractive and spacious rear of terrace property located in popular Birkby, set over four floors with three bedrooms and a pretty paved and decked garden. Will appeal to first time buyers, buy-to-let- investors and downsizers.


DESCRIPTION
The property is located in popular Birkby, close to the town centre in Huddersfield. The village has Primary, Infant and Nursery Schools close by. Access to the M62 motorway link is close at hand and Birkby offers an excellent bus service into the town centre and surrounding villages.

Property Details 


Ground Floor 


Entrance Hallway 
Enter the property into the hallway.

Lounge 11' 5" x 14' 10" ( 3.48m x 4.52m )
The lounge is attractively decorated and has a focal point open fireplace with multi-fuel burning stove, a radiator, television and telephone points, stripped floorboards and original, fully restored and draft proofed sash window.

Kitchen 6' 5" x 11' 8" max ( 1.96m x 3.56m max )
Fitted with a good range of stylish contemporary wall and base units with solid wood work surfaces incorporating a Belfast sink.
Appliances include a gas oven and hob and there are spaces for white goods. The central heating boiler is housed here and the room has an original fully restored and draft proofed sash window, stripped floorboards and a door leading down to the cellar.


Cellar 9' 11" x 11' 11" ( 3.02m x 3.63m )
The useful, dry storage cellar is fully tanked and has a paved stone floor, a radiator and a single glazed door to the rear elevation.

First Floor 


Landing 
A staircase rises from the lounge to the first floor accommodation. Doors lead to two bedrooms and the bathroom. A staircase rises to the second floor attic bedroom.

Bedroom One 8' 9" into recess x 14' 11" ( 2.67m into recess x 4.55m )
A neutrally decorated double bedroom boasting an original feature fireplace. Having a radiator and an original fully restored and draft proofed sash window.

Bedroom Two 6' 3" x 8' 10" ( 1.91m x 2.69m )
This second neutrally decorated bedroom has a radiator, built in shelving and an original fully restored and draft proofed sash window.

Bathroom 
Furnished with a modern white suite comprising bath with shower over, contemporary wash hand basin with feature tap set upon a vanity unit with cupboard beneath and a WC. The room is part tiled and has Lino flooring, a heated towel rail and a frosted double glazed window.

Second Floor 


Bedroom Three 20' 2" x 9' 2" max ( 6.15m x 2.79m max )
(converted prior to the requirement for building regulations)
This extremely spacious room has a radiator, storage into the eaves and a double glazed Velux window.

External Details 
The garden is really attractive feature of the property. It comprises paved and decked patio areas along with a neat lawn and rockery. A further decked, covered area is the perfect place for outdoor seating, from which to enjoy the surroundings. The garden has gated access and fenced boundaries.
